Quick Overview
Daqiq is a Saudi cloud platform combining accounting, POS, and inventory in one integrated system, with very competitive pricing, full Arabic support, and ZATCA-certified e-invoicing.
Al-Ostaz is a cloud accounting program specialized in organizing accounts and invoices, known for its simple interface, but it lacks some advanced POS and inventory features.
Official 2026 Pricing Comparison
| Plan | Daqiq ⭐ | Al-Ostaz |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Basic | 49 SAR/mo | 52 SAR/mo | Daqiq cheaper by 3 SAR |
| Advanced | 82 SAR/mo | 82 SAR/mo | Equal |
| Professional | 170 SAR/mo | 174 SAR/mo | Daqiq cheaper by 4 SAR |
Important note: Daqiq is cheaper or equal across all plans, and includes POS and advanced inventory management in every plan at no extra cost, while Al-Ostaz requires paid add-ons for these features.

Features: Who Offers More?
Point of Sale (POS)
Daqiq: Full integrated POS with printing support, barcode, and kitchen display for restaurants — included in the base plan!
Al-Ostaz: Limited POS, requires paid add-ons for full functionality.
Inventory Management
Daqiq: Multi-branch inventory, periodic stocktake, low-stock alerts, and movement reports.
Al-Ostaz: Basic inventory management, higher tier required for most advanced features.
ZATCA E-Invoicing
Both are compliant with Phase 1 and 2 of ZATCA. The difference is Daqiq offers 19 additional free tools like QR generator, VAT calculator, invoice generator, end-of-service calculator, and more — for immediate use without signup.
